Examine your Stress as well as Temperature Valves


Your water heater's temperature level and also stress shutoffs regulate the temperature level as well as pressure within the water heater container. These valves will prevent a surge if your container gets too hot or if the stress surpasses risk-free levels.
Unfortunately, these safety and security tools provide no warning when they spoil. You can validate your valve's effectiveness by hanging on to the shutoff's lever. If it is in good condition, water needs to flow out. If no water drains or only a trickle is launched, hurry and also obtain your valves fixed.

Wait numerous hours for the water tank to warm up


It will take your water heater numerous hours to completely warm up, so inspect it periodically by activating a faucet to see to it it's obtaining warm. The advised temperature is 120 ° F (49 ° C.

Scan for fire dangers.


As you check your shutoffs, offer its surroundings a twice. Scan the area for fire dangers, especially if you make use of a gas-powered water heater.
First, check for combustible materials like fuel, gas containers, as well as other heat-generating devices. Next, check for littles paper as well as wood, consisting of trash. Do not dispose of your garbage near to your water heater devices.
You would do well to keep any kind of clothing far from your hot water heater. Ought to a fire start, these products will promote its spread. That said, your washing line ought to not be close to your water heater.

Constantly maintain appropriate ventilation.


If your hot water heater isn't properly aired vent, it'll lead fumes right into your home. This might trigger respiratory system problems as well as give you cough or an allergy.
An excellent vent should face up or have a vertical angle, leading the smoke away from the home. If your air vent doesn't follow this style, it might be an installation error.
You require a plumber's help to repair inadequate water heater ventilation.

Educate your household exactly how to switch off the hot water heater.


Throughout this tour, show your family how to turn off the heating unit, particularly if it is a gas heating unit. They must likewise understand when to transform it off. For instance, if there is a gas leakage, if the water stress goes down as well reduced, or if the water heater is overheating. You should also switch off your hot water heater when you'll be away for a couple of days, as well as when the tank is empty.

Constantly predetermined the maximum temperature level.


Warm water burns in your home are common. You can avoid accidents, conserve power and also be kind to the environment simply by presetting your hot water heater's optimum temperature. The most hassle-free warm water temperature is 120F. Water at this temperature level is risk-free for adults, children, and also the elderly.

When You Should Turn off Your Water Heater


For the most part, a water heater is a pretty easy-going appliance. You can depend on a tank water heater to give you 10-15 years of dependable hot water – and all it asks is for some periodic maintenance in return.



However, there are times when taking care of the unit comes into consideration. Often, our customers will ask, “Do I need to turn off my water heater if….” Here are answers to three common scenarios.




When the main water supply is shut off


There are many circumstances in which the main water supply is turned off. When this happens, many homeowners wonder if it’s safe to keep the water heater on of it should be shut down too.



In most cases, it may not be necessary to turn off the water heater, but it also won’t hurt, either. However, there are two reasons when you should turn off the unit to prevent too much pressure or heat from building up inside the tank:


  • The tank is empty (or close to it) and won’t be refilled for a long period of time


  • The main water supply loses pressure


  • When you go on vacation


    When you go on vacation or plan on being away from an extended period of time, there are the usual routines for prepping your home. You may adjust your heating or cooling system, set automatic lights, and put a hold on your mail. But what about your water heater?



    While it may seem logical to shut off the water heater when not in use to save energy, it may not be as beneficial as you think. First, it can be disruptive and hard on the unit to be turned on and off. When you get home, you’ll be without hot water and might run into issues with turning the unit back on. Instead, set your water heater for “VAC” mode (a common feature on newer water heater models) or turn down the water temperature to 50 degrees. This will help you save energy without risking other issues.


    When there’s a leak


    If your water heater springs a leak due for a variety of reasons, including age or a valve malfunction, you should always turn off the unit and shut off the water supply until the issue is resolved.
